In Luttrell's own official after-action report filed with his superiors after his rescue, he estimated the size of the Taliban force to be around 20–35. Luttrell claims in his book that during the briefing his team was told around 80 to 200 fighters were expected to be in the area. Initial intel estimated approximately 10 to 20. Luttrell was in the audience though, and he was watching his friends die in all of Hollywood's glory ...Marcus Luttrell (born November 7, 1975) is a former United States Navy SEAL, who received the Navy Cross and Purple Heart for his actions in June 2005 facing Taliban fighters during Operation Red Wings. Luttrell was a Hospital Corpsman First Class by the end of his eight-year career in the United States Navy. But miraculously, as the film ... Marcus Luttrell’s Escape. On the ground and nearly out of ammunition, the four SEALs, Murphy, Luttrell, Dietz, and Axelson, continued the fight. Murphy, Axelson, and Dietz had been killed by the end of the two-hour gunfight that careened through the hills and over cliffs. An estimated 35 Taliban were also dead.Set in 2005, the biographical war film is based on a book by the lone survivor of the mission, Marcus Luttrell.
